R600/SI: Wrap local memory pointer in AssertZExt on SI
These pointers are really just offsets and they will always be less than 16-bits. Using AssertZExt allows us to use computeKnownBits to prove that these values are positive. We will use this information in a later commit. git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@216277 91177308-0d34-0410-b5e6-96231b3b80d8
